What if addiction isn't a moral failure… but a nervous system mismatch?

In this episode of Strategic Recovery with Matt Finch, we explore the powerful link between neurodiversity and addiction — and why sensitive, intense, empathic, impulsive, and differently wired brains are often more vulnerable to substance use.

But here's the twist:

The same wiring that increases vulnerability can become extraordinary strength in recovery.

Matt shares his personal story of growing up feeling "different" — highly sensitive, intuitive, intense, and misunderstood — and how discovering the language of neurodiversity years after entering recovery dissolved decades of hidden shame.

This episode breaks down:

  • The difference between disorder and wiring variation
  • The "Breadth & Intensity" model of neurodivergent traits
  • How Highly Sensitive People (HSPs), Empaths, ADHD traits, High Sensation Seekers, and Autism spectrum traits relate to addiction risk
  • Why alcohol or benzodiazepines can feel stabilizing for some
  • Why stimulants can feel calming
  • Why opioids can feel like emotional insulation
  • The Vulnerability Equation: when wiring meets trauma, rejection, and no language
  • How mainstream recovery models often miss nervous system variation
  • The Strategic Recovery™ calibration model for the wired different

You'll learn why addiction often begins as improvised nervous system regulation — and how understanding your wiring reduces shame, increases regulation, and lowers relapse risk.
